技术问答类推广文案:GBase 数据库部署详细教程
一、什么是 GBase 数据库?
GBase 是由南大通用(GreatSQL)推出的一款高性能、高可用的关系型数据库系统,广泛应用于金融、电信、政务等对数据安全和性能要求极高的行业。GBase 支持多种部署模式,包括单机部署、主从复制、集群部署等,能够满足不同规模企业的数据管理需求。
在实际应用中,许多开发者和运维人员需要了解如何快速、高效地部署 GBase 数据库。接下来我们将通过问答形式,为您详细介绍 GBase 的部署流程与关键步骤。
二、GBase 数据库部署常见问题解答
Q1: 部署 GBase 前需要准备哪些环境?
A: 在部署 GBase 之前,建议您完成以下准备工作:
- 操作系统支持:GBase 支持 Linux(如 CentOS、Ubuntu)和 Windows 系统。
- 硬件要求:根据业务负载选择合适的 CPU、内存和磁盘空间。
- 依赖软件安装:确保已安装 JDK、MySQL 客户端工具等必要组件。
- 网络配置:确保服务器之间网络互通,防火墙设置合理,开放相关端口(如 3306)。
Q2: 如何下载 GBase 安装包?
A: 您可以通过以下方式获取 GBase 安装包:
- 访问 GBase 官方网站 或联系官方技术支持。
- 下载适用于您操作系统的安装包(如 .tar.gz 或 .rpm 文件)。
- 推荐使用最新稳定版本以获得更好的性能和安全性。
Q3: GBase 单机部署步骤是什么?
A: 单机部署是初学者入门的首选方式,以下是基本步骤:
- 上传安装包:将下载的 GBase 安装包上传至目标服务器。
- 解压文件:使用
tar -zxvf gbase-xxx.tar.gz
解压安装包。 - 修改配置文件:编辑
gbase.conf
文件,设置数据库路径、端口、字符集等参数。 - 执行安装脚本:运行
./install.sh
启动安装过程。 - 启动服务:使用
./bin/gbased
启动数据库服务。 - 验证部署:通过
mysql -u root -p
登录数据库,确认是否成功部署。
Q4: 如何进行 GBase 主从复制部署?
A: 主从复制可以提升数据库的读写性能和容灾能力,步骤如下:
- 主库配置:
- 修改
my.cnf
文件,开启二进制日志并设置唯一 server-id。 -
创建用于复制的用户并授权。
-
从库配置:
- 设置不同的 server-id。
- 使用
CHANGE MASTER TO
命令配置主库信息。 -
启动复制进程:
START SLAVE;
-
验证同步状态:
- 使用
SHOW SLAVE STATUS\G
查看复制状态,确保没有错误。
Q5: GBase 集群部署有哪些优势?
A: GBase 支持多节点集群部署,具备以下优势:
- 高可用性:通过故障转移机制保障服务连续性。
- 负载均衡:多节点分担请求压力,提升系统吞吐量。
- 数据一致性:采用分布式事务机制,保证跨节点数据一致。
集群部署通常需要结合 ZooKeeper 或其他协调服务实现节点管理,具体步骤较为复杂,建议参考官方文档或联系技术支持。
三、GBase 数据库部署注意事项
- 备份与恢复:定期备份数据库,防止数据丢失。
- 权限管理:严格控制用户权限,避免越权访问。
- 性能调优:根据业务场景调整缓存大小、连接池参数等。
- 监控与日志:启用数据库监控工具,及时发现异常。
四、结语:掌握 GBase 部署,提升数据库管理能力
GBase 数据库以其稳定性、高性能和易用性受到越来越多企业青睐。无论是单机部署还是集群架构,掌握其部署流程都是数据库工程师必备技能之一。
如果您正在寻找一份专业且易懂的 GBase 数据库部署详细教程,欢迎关注我们的技术专栏,获取更多实战经验与部署指南。
立即学习 GBase 部署,开启您的数据库优化之旅!